Introduction of Zebra Finches
Zebra finches, clinically called Taeniopygia guttata, are small, social birds native to Australia. They are popular pets due to their friendly nature, ease of care, and very little space requirements. Typically, they have a life expectancy of 5-10 years, but with proper care, they can live longer.

Getting Ready For Zebra Finch Ownership
Environment Setup
Before bringing home zebra finches, it's necessary to create an ideal environment. Here are some pointers:
- Cage Size: A cage needs to be at least 24" long, 18" high, and 18" deep to enable the birds to fly and explore.
- Perches: Include several perches of varying sizes to keep their feet healthy.
- Nesting Material: Provide nesting product like turf or dried leaves if you prepare to reproduce your finches.
- Food and Water Dishes: Use shallow meals that are simple for the finches to gain access to.
Choosing the Right Diet
Zebra finches need a balanced diet plan to remain healthy. Here's a table laying out a normal dietary program:
| Food Type | Advised Sources |
|---|---|
| Seed Mix | High-quality finch seed blend |
| Fresh Vegetables | Leafy greens, carrots, broccoli |
| Fruits | Apples, berries, and citrus (Graupapagei In Not moderation) |
| Calcium Supplement | Cuttlebone or mineral block |

Assessing Healthy Birds
No matter where you buy your zebra finches, it's important to pick healthy birds. Try to find indications of great health, including:
- Bright, clear eyes
- Tidy plumes without any signs of mites
- Active and social behavior
- No indications of breathing problems, like wheezing or nasal discharge

FAQs About Buying Zebra Finches
1. Can I keep zebra finches alone?
While zebra finches can live alone, they are very social animals and thrive in sets or small groups. It's best to have at least 2 to encourage social interaction.
2. Do zebra finches need a companion?
Yes, zebra finches are best kept in sets or groups. This avoids loneliness and encourages natural habits.
3. What is the finest time of year to buy zebra finches?
There isn't a particular season; however, spring is typically a popular time for new family pet birds as lots of breeders have young birds offered.
4. How much space do zebra finches need?
Zebra finches need adequate space to fly around, so a cage that is at least 24 inches long is recommended.
5. Can zebra finches be hand-tamed?
Yes, zebra finches can be hand-tamed, however this needs persistence and consistent favorable interactions. Start sluggish and enable the birds to get utilized to your existence.
